BMW 1-Series M Performance Edition Launched

In a bid to add sport quotient and appeal to the 1-Series, BMW has launched the BMW 1-Series M Performance Editionย in India with visual enhancements to the luxury hatchback. Though the M badge is the most sought after property in the market only 111 units of the 1-Series M performance edition will be produced andย will be available at the BMW dealerships till July 25, 2014.

The limited edition gets a handful of exterior updates such as a black front grill, performance rear spoiler with fins, BMW M aerodynamics, performance racing stripes and M Performance lettering on the exteriors. However, cosmetic facelift apart, no mechanical changes have been made to the vehicle.

Price

  • BMW 116i M Performance Edition: Rs 22.65 Lakh
  • BMW 118d M Performance Edition: Rs 25.60 Lakh
  • BMW 118d Sport M Performance Edition: Rs 28.55 Lakh
  • BMW 118d Sport Plus M Performance Edition: Rs 32.50 Lakh

Dealerships are offering the BMWs most affordable model in the country, 1-Series M Performance edition with an EMI of Rs 19,999ย and trade-in benefits of Rs. 50,000.

Apart from the visual enhancements, there have been no changes made to the powertrain. Available with petrol and diesel engine options, the BMW 1-Series is powered by a 1.6-litre, 4-cylinder petrol unit producing 136 BHP of power and 220 Nm of torque, while the diesel variant uses a 2.0-litre 4-cylinder engine producing 143 BHP and 320 Nm of torque. 0-100 km/hr comes up in 8.7 seconds on the petrol version and takes just 0.1 second lesser on the diesel powered model.

BMW has strategically launched the M performance edition for the 1-Series in competition with Mercedes A-Class Edition 1 version, which was launched earlier this month. Now both the hatchbacks offer a whole lot of updates and additional features that made the hatchback a compelling buy in the segment. Launched in September 2013, the BMW 1-Series completes 10 months of sales and has been doing moderately well for BMW India. The 1-Series M Performance edition will help the automaker generate more short term sales, while keeping the model popular in the segment rivaling against Mercedes A-Class, Volvo V40 Cross Country and the upcoming Audi A3.
